Level sensors for the determination of the water level can be connected to the level
connections (mini DIN sockets: Level 1 & 2 purple, 3 & 4 green). Since these are double-
allocated sockets, you can connect two level sensors per socket using a splitter cable (Y-cable
PL-LY; not included).
Expansion cards can be used to increase the number of level inputs in ProfiLux 4 or Expansion
Box 2.
The numbering of the sensor inputs is continuous and begins with the sensors permanently
installed in the ProfiLux, followed by the sensor inputs of expansion cards (if available). The
fixed inputs of the first expansion box are then counted, then the sensor inputs of expansion
cards in the first Expansion box. The numbering of sensor inputs of further expansion boxes
is continued according to the same system.
Since the level control is a sensitive matter, various safety precautions have been taken. Our
sensors and the evaluation electronics are designed in such a way that a withdrawal of the
sensor plug or a cable break is interpreted as reaching the desired level and the
corresponding socket is switched off.
In addition to the more cost-effective mechanical float operated sensors, we also offer
optical or contact-less sensors (without mechanical parts). These cannot get stuck in a
position due to contamination. Furthermore, time limits are adjustable which limit the
switching duration of the sockets. Thereby, overflow due to a defect can be prevented in
most cases.
You can adjust the following level controls:
Control
Input
Diagnostic
After you have selected a level control, you can edit its settings.
Note
After setting the level control (function), please assign the sockets
(hardware) to be switched by the level control, see also under System->
Socket outlet function.
